电话拨号器和短信发送器是Android初学者很好的练习项目,今天就找了两个写得很不错的例子学习下电话拨号器实现原理:用户输入电话号码,当点击拨打的时候,由监听对象捕获,监听对象通过文本控件获取到用户输入的电话号码,由于系统已经实现了电话拨号功能,所以我们只需要调用这个功能就可以了。步骤:1.界面布局...
分类:
移动开发 时间:
2014-10-22 00:33:50
阅读次数:
315
前些日子接到了一个面试电话,面试内容我印象很深,如何模拟一个并发?当时我的回答虽然也可以算是正确的,但自己感觉缺乏实际可以操作的细节,只有一个大概的描述。
当时我的回答是:“线程全部在同一节点wait,然后在某个节点notifyAll。”
面试官:“那你听说过惊群效应吗?”
我:“我没有听过这个名词,但我知道瞬间唤醒所有的线程,会让CPU负载瞬间加大。”
...
分类:
编程语言 时间:
2014-10-21 19:45:12
阅读次数:
247
在主active onCreate函数中实现 @Override public void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); super.set...
分类:
其他好文 时间:
2014-10-21 19:15:30
阅读次数:
117
主流网站在设计上的一些特点: 一、网站以用户邮件和手机号码的方式来确定用户的唯一性,防止用户过度注册。 二、网站为了保护网站数据,没有删除用户的功能(比如用户发表的文章,肯定不能因为用户的删除而删除,不然数据肯定会出现一些问题)。 三、网站允许用户使用电话号码或者邮箱作为用户名,允许通过用...
分类:
移动开发 时间:
2014-10-21 19:07:40
阅读次数:
206
使用phonegap开发手机APP,常常需要更改代码之后进行调试,使用安卓模拟器每次启动非常缓慢,而且不能保证最终在真机上的效果。所以一般都采用真机进行调试。搭建真机的调试环境这里就不再赘述了,网上有很多教程。这里主要讲一下本人在nodejs命令行方式下进行run的时候的报错问题,当输入cordov...
分类:
数据库 时间:
2014-10-21 17:25:37
阅读次数:
212
之前本博连载过《构建跨平台APP:jQuery Mobile移动应用实战》一书,深受移动开发入门人员的喜爱。 从现在开始,连载它的孪生姐妹书phoneGap移动应用实战一书,希望曾经是小白的你们,已经变成了大白。 3.6? Ph...
分类:
移动开发 时间:
2014-10-21 15:44:52
阅读次数:
164
之前本博连载过《构建跨平台APP:jQueryMobile移动应用实战》一书,深受移动开发入门人员的喜爱。从现在开始,连载它的孪生姐妹书phoneGap移动应用实战一书,希望曾经是小白的你们,已经变成了大白。3.6PhoneGap中的API能干什么本章主要介绍进行PhoneGap开发前所需要做好的准备..
分类:
移动开发 时间:
2014-10-21 15:37:40
阅读次数:
185
之前本博连载过《构建跨平台APP:jQuery Mobile移动应用实战》一书,深受移动开发入门人员的喜爱。
从现在开始,连载它的孪生姐妹书phoneGap移动应用实战一书,希望曾经是小白的你们,已经变成了大白。
分类:
移动开发 时间:
2014-10-21 15:11:45
阅读次数:
155
之前本博连载过《构建跨平台APP:jQuery Mobile移动应用实战》一书,深受移动开发入门人员的喜爱。
从现在开始,连载它的孪生姐妹书phoneGap移动应用实战一书,希望曾经是小白的你们,已经变成了大白。...
分类:
移动开发 时间:
2014-10-21 13:51:01
阅读次数:
143
在mysql中concat函数有一个特点就是有一个值为null那么不管第二个字符有多少内容都返回为空了,这个特性让我们在实例应用中可能觉得不方便,但实现就是这样我们需要使用其它办法来解决。天在做opencart开发的时候,需要对用户表中用户的电话号码和区号连接起来,于是使用了concat方法,代码如...
分类:
数据库 时间:
2014-10-21 12:06:37
阅读次数:
157